Output 60696480a65f13cd2562b1f38dc7bda513fe3b686f7eb58f987d2ee0a0cb2c2e:13

value
20100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44300e2a9ba81d38f7ba9b1e8ef48305fa54d943 OP_EQUAL
address
37uZSXnceJsmYxKCE58GgquedLA2EygVhk
transaction
60696480a65f13cd2562b1f38dc7bda513fe3b686f7eb58f987d2ee0a0cb2c2e
spent
true